😏provocative

adjective
/prəˈvɒkətɪv/

Meaning

Intended to make people angry, excited, or interested.

Example Sentences

She wore a provocative dress to the party.

Example Expressions

provocative remark

Synonyms

challenging, stimulating, inciting, arousing, inflammatory

Antonyms

calming, soothing, reassuring

Collocations

provocative statement, provocative behavior, sexually provocative, provocative dress
